PicSee URL shortener with QR code generation, analytics charts, and link management via CLI. Use when the user asks to shorten a URL, generate QR codes, visualize analytics, list/search links, or mentions PicSee. Supports unauthenticated mode (basic shortening + QR codes + charts) and authenticated mode (full analytics, editing, search). Token stored with AES-256-CBC encryption.

Works with any agent that can run shell commands (OpenClaw, Claude Code, Codex, etc.). --- ## CLI Path ``` node ~/.openclaw/workspace/skills/picsee-short-link/cli/dist/cli.js ``` For brevity, examples below use `picsee` as alias. --- ## Quick Reference ### Shorten a URL ```bash picsee shorten "https://example.com/long-url" picsee shorten "https://example.com" --slug mylink picsee shorten "https://example.com" --slug mylink --domain pse.is --title "My Title" --tags seo,marketing ``` ### Analytics ```bash picsee analytics mylink ``` ### Generate Analytics Chart ```bash picsee chart mylink ``` Fetches analytics and returns a QuickChart URL visualizing daily clicks. ### Generate QR Code ```bash picsee qr "https://pse.is/mylink" picsee qr "https://pse.is/mylink" --size 500 ``` ### List Links ```bash picsee list picsee list --limit 10 picsee list --start "2026-03-31T23:59:59" --keyword "campaign" picsee list --tag seo --starred ``` `--start` queries backward from that time (default: now). **Use the END of the period**, e.g. `2026-03-31T23:59:59` for March 2026. ### Edit a Link ```bash picsee edit mylink --url "https://new-destination.com" picsee edit mylink --slug newslug --title "New Title" --tags a,b,c ``` Requires Advanced plan. ### Delete / Recover ```bash picsee delete mylink picsee recover mylink ``` ### Authentication ```bash picsee auth <token> picsee auth-status ``` Token source: https://picsee.io → avatar → Settings → API → Copy token. ### Help ```bash picsee help ``` --- ## Full Options ### `shorten` | Flag | Description | |------|-------------| | `--slug <slug>` | Custom slug (3-90 chars) | | `--domain <domain>` | Short link domain (default: `pse.is`) | | `--title <title>` | Preview title (Advanced plan) | | `--desc <desc>` | Preview description (Advanced plan) | | `--image <url>` | Preview thumbnail (Advanced plan) | | `--tags t1,t2` | Comma-separated tags (Advanced plan) | | `--utm s:m:c:t:n` | UTM params — source:medium:campaign:term:content | ### `list` | Flag | Description | |------|-------------| | `--start <time>` | Query backward from this time (default: now) | | `--limit <n>` | Results per page (1-50, default 50) | | `--keyword <kw>` | Search title/description (Advanced, 3-30 chars) | | `--tag <tag>` | Filter by tag (Advanced) | | `--url <url>` | Filter by exact destination URL | | `--slug <slug>` | Filter by exact slug | | `--starred` | Starred links only | | `--api-only` | API-generated links only | | `--cursor <mapId>` | Pagination cursor | ### `edit` | Flag | Description | |------|-------------| | `--url <url>` | New destination URL | | `--slug <slug>` | New slug | | `--domain <domain>` | New domain | | `--title <title>` | New preview title | | `--desc <desc>` | New preview description | | `--image <url>` | New preview thumbnail | | `--tags t1,t2` | New tags | | `--expire <iso>` | Expiration time (ISO 8601) | --- ## Auth Modes | Mode | API Host | Features | |------|----------|----------| | **Unauthenticated** | `chrome-ext.picsee.tw` | Create short links only | | **Authenticated** | `api.pics.ee` | Create + analytics + list + search + edit + delete | Auto-detected: if encrypted token exists at `~/.openclaw/.picsee_token`, authenticated mode is used. --- ## Security - **Token encryption**: AES-256-CBC, IV stored alongside ciphertext - **Key derivation**: `SHA-256(random-salt + hostname + "-" + username)` — the 32-byte random salt is generated once and stored at `~/.openclaw/.picsee_salt` (mode `0600`), making the key unpredictable even if hostname/username are known - **File permissions**: `0600` on both token and salt files --- ## Agent Recipes (Post-Processing) ### Download QR Code as Image After `picsee qr`, download and send the image: ```bash mkdir -p ~/.openclaw/workspace/skills/picsee-short-link/tmp curl -s -o ~/.openclaw/workspace/skills/picsee-short-link/tmp/<ENCODE_ID>_qr.png "<originalQrUrl>" ``` Send via `message` tool with `filePath: "~/.openclaw/workspace/skills/picsee-short-link/tmp/<ENCODE_ID>_qr.png"`. ### Download Chart as Image After `picsee chart`, download and send the image: ```bash mkdir -p ~/.openclaw/workspace/skills/picsee-short-link/tmp curl -s -o ~/.openclaw/workspace/skills/picsee-short-link/tmp/<ENCODE_ID>_chart.png "<originalChartUrl>" ``` Send via `message` tool with `filePath: "~/.openclaw/workspace/skills/picsee-short-link/tmp/<ENCODE_ID>_chart.png"`.
